become gloomy
Frequency: 6.811.0 per million words
To begin to be gloomy.

Examples (10)
- By late afternoon, the sky became gloomy and the first drops began to fall.
- As the economic data rolled in, investors became gloomy about the market’s prospects.
- Try not to become gloomy just because the plans changed.
- Her expression has become gloomy since the phone call.
- The once bright corridor is becoming gloomy as the lights flicker out.
- If the forecast is right, the weekend will become gloomy by Sunday.
- The mood in the office became gloomy after the announcement.
- He tends to become gloomy in winter when the days get short.
- Their outlook has become gloomy despite the early success.
- Don’t let the room become gloomy; open the curtains and switch on a lamp.
